I love, love, love inspirational quotes. I have them taped and pinned everywhere in my office. On my monitor, the keyboard, the desk, the bulletin board, the wall...you get the idea. I firmly believe that something you hear or read can change your life, even if it's just in a small way. It may be just what you need to get you going in the morning. For me though, some of these quotes are what keep me up at night. Literally. I'll be so tired, and think I can't look at one more image. I just can't do it. Then, I'll look around my desk and see something that will get me back in gear.



There is actually a story behind the quote for today. There is a fabulous photographer in Michigan, Amy Wenzel, whose husband, David, just found out that he has a brain tumor. She posted a blog about it, and linked to David's blog where he's updating about his condition. When I clicked on his blog, this quote was in the top of the sidebar. It struck me, because it was exactly what I needed today. Sometimes I get paralyzed by fear, both in my life and in my business. I realized today, that will get me run over.
